How much do remote retail internships j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ote retail internships in the United States is $15.67,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$16.59 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Retail Int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Retail Intern, you need a basic understanding of retail operations, analytical skills, and often a background in business or marketing studies. Familiarity with e-commerce platforms, CRM software, and productivity tools like Microsoft Office or Google Workspace is typically expected. Strong communication, time management, and self-motivation are standout soft skills for remote collaboration and independent work. These abilities are crucial for effectively contributing to retail projects, adapting to digital work environments, and supporting team goals from a distance.

What are remote retail internships?

Remote retail internships are work experiences in the retail industry that can be completed from a remote location, such as your home, rather than a physical store or office. These internships often involve tasks like online customer service, digital marketing, inventory management, market research, and e-commerce operations. They give students and recent graduates hands-on experience with real retail projects, while also building valuable skills in communication, technology, and teamwork. Remote retail internships are ideal for those who want to gain industry experience with flexibility and without geographic constraints.

How do remote retail internships typically structure mentorship and team collaboration for interns?

Remote retail internships often utilize virtual platforms to facilitate mentorship and team collaboration. Interns are usually assigned a dedicated mentor or supervisor who provides regular check-ins, guidance on projects, and feedback sessions. Team meetings are commonly held via video conferencing tools, and collaboration happens through shared documents, chat platforms, and project management software. This structure ensures interns remain engaged, supported, and able to contribute meaningfully to the team despite working remotely.

What is the difference between Remote Retail Internships vs Remote Retail Associate?

AspectRemote Retail InternshipsRemote Retail Associate
Required CredentialsTypically students or entry-level, some may require coursework in retail or businessHigh school diploma or equivalent; some retail experience preferred
Work EnvironmentRemote, often project-based or seasonalRemote, ongoing customer service and sales support
Employer & Industry UsageRetail companies, e-commerce platforms, startupsRetail stores, online retailers, supermarkets
Common Search & Comparison IntentLearning opportunities, entry-level experienceCustomer support, sales assistance

Remote Retail Internships are typically designed for students or those new to retail, focusing on gaining experience in a flexible, remote setting. Remote Retail Associates are more experienced roles providing ongoing customer service and sales support remotely. While internships are often temporary and educational, associate roles are ongoing positions within retail companies.
